# Branding

**What is allowed**

Use BCA Brand Assets only when you are:

* ✅ Referring to our products and services
* ✅ Linking to our official site or products, such as "partnering with BCA"
* ✅ Announcing an official partnership, but only if you have **official approval** by a qualified member of the BCA Labs team

For information on other uses of our Brand Assets, please reach out at <contact@bcaprotocol.com>

**What is not allowed**

* ⛔️ **Don't use our Brand Assets in your products' name, logo, NFTs, etc.**&#x20;
* ⛔️ **Don't use our Brand Assets to create digital or physical products for sale**
* ⛔️ **Don't create derivative names that imply official endorsement (i.E community channels)**
* ⛔️ **Don't change or adapt our Brand Assets in any way**

Use your common sense and creativity. If you want to make something relating to the Blockchain-Ads ecosystem, make it your own. Have fun making a unique brand that's clearly yours - if your product is strong, you won't need to rely on remixing Blockchain-Ads brand.
